Book Blurb
Can the man of Lauren’s dreams save her from the man in her
nightmares?
Wes Dunlop was a hot commodity in high school and
the ruin of good reputations, so it was easy to criticize the guy when his
sister did it too. Then Lauren McKay actually met her best friend’s brother,
and she was intrigued. When he came to her rescue, she was doomed. Afraid to
admit her change of heart, Lauren hid her secret from both of them.
Fifteen years later Wes is back. Now a dedicated
cop, he’s determined to win Lauren—the girl he can’t forget and the only one
his sister demanded he leave alone. But he finds that Lauren’s life is a lot
more complicated than he imagined.
Personal
tragedy made Lauren a fierce defender of battered women. However, when a
dangerous gunman tracks his wife to Lauren’s shelter, the protector becomes the
target. Her life suddenly in the balance, nothing will stop Wes from doing
everything in his power to rescue her.
Book Excerpt
Lauren shook her head and went searching in her handbag for a tissue. Blotting her eyes and wiping her nose, she finally sobbed, “I feel like I don’t even know Sherry anymore.”
Wes gripped the back of her headrest, wishing he could stroke her hair instead. “Sure you do.”
“I didn’t know any of her friends. I’ve been replaced. It’s like we’re strangers. I’ve missed so much.”
Now he understood. “Do you care about Sherry?”
“Yes,” said Lauren without hesitation.
“Then you have to make the effort to repair the friendship. Just because Sherry has new friends doesn’t mean she doesn’t want you in her life too. You have to reestablish your connection, that’s all. It isn’t going to happen overnight or even in two short hours. What did you expect?”
She threw up her hands. “I don’t know.”
He’d never seen a more forlorn expression in his life. The tears clinging to Lauren’s lashes were too much for him. Expelling a deep sigh, Wes cupped the back of her neck and pulled her in. His kiss was soft, compassionate, and infinitely tender. The wet tissue in Lauren’s hand flattened out against his shirt and he felt the moisture leech through the light cotton, dampening his skin underneath. He didn’t give a damn.
The timing was wrong, all wrong, and yet he couldn’t help himself. The need to be close to her, comfort and caress her was almost unbearable. In his mind he’d held back long enough. Now it was up to her. If Lauren pulled away or asked him to stop he would.
She clutched his shirt instead.

Toot's Review by Stacy Sabala
Lauren had the biggest crush on Wes, even though he went
after anything in a skirt and her best friend was his little sister,
Sherry. She knew about every girl he
dated which was more than she liked but she loved him just the same. No one knew how she felt. She kept her feelings to herself, not even
telling Sherry. Wes left for college and
moved on, but Lauren still pined for him and knew she loved him. Then her older sister was murdered and Lauren
withdrew from her friend. She distanced
herself from everything and started her crusade of saving as many battered
women as she could with the shelter she ran.
Then one day when welcoming a new woman and her children
into her shelter, she comes face to face with Wes. Her shock is clear and throws her life into a
crazy spin. She still loves him even
years later. Wes is now a cop and is
just as shocked to see Lauren. Unknown
to anyone, he has also harbored feelings and fantasies of his own. He helps her reconnect to Sherry then rescues her when their worlds collide in a scary way.
This CR was a great read.
The characters were well written and came across as real people as you
watched the story unfold. They struggled
with their feelings and Lauren’s insecurities were tough to overcome. The love scenes were written to entice but
left enough to the reader’s imagination.
This was an excellent story with just enough action and reality to keep
the reader avidly reading. I couldn't put it down. I give it 4 out of 5 books.
